Finance & Stewardship Update / November 11, 2020

Year to date, we have raised 67% of our budgeted contribution revenue. Nobody likes to come up short at the end of a budget cycle. To move NGFM to stop relying on money from the Sampson bequest, which has an end date, we set a goal of increasing our contribution income by 10% in 2020. Called Meeting / November 15, 2020

We will have a Called Meeting on First Day (Sunday) November 15 at 2 p.m. The purpose of the meeting is to discuss the different Quaker organizations (PFYM, PFF, Quaker House, etc.) that New Garden is associated with. We are looking to discern how we best can support and take part in these groups. More information is forthcoming. – Tim Lindeman, Presiding Clerk

Peace & Social Concerns Notes / November 11, 2020

The Peace and Social Concerns Committee is working to help New Garden Friends Meeting incorporate more immediate social and economic justice actions into our everyday lives. Thus, every weekly newsletter will include one Anti-Racist Action suggestion and one website whereby members can find minority-owned business to support, if they so choose.
